In the rapidly evolving financial landscape, traditional portfolio management methods are increasingly being supplemented—or replaced—by AI-driven solutions. These systems leverage machine learning and deep reinforcement learning (DRL) to automate trading strategies, optimize asset allocation, and enhance decision-making processes. A notable example is DeepQuery, an agency specializing in developing AI-powered solutions for financial markets.
Financial institutions face several challenges in portfolio management:
Data Overload: The sheer volume and complexity of financial data make manual analysis inefficient and error-prone.
Market Volatility: Rapid market changes require real-time decision-making, which is challenging for human traders.
Risk Management: Balancing risk and return is complex, especially in volatile markets.
Operational Efficiency: Manual processes are time-consuming and may not capitalize on market opportunities promptly.
DeepQuery developed an AI-powered portfolio management system that integrates several advanced techniques:
Deep Q-Learning: A form of DRL where an agent learns optimal trading actions by interacting with the market environment. This approach has been shown to outperform traditional methods in portfolio optimization .
Predictive Analytics: Utilizing machine learning models to forecast market trends and asset performance.
Automated Trading Algorithms: Executing trades based on predefined strategies and real-time data analysis.
Risk Assessment Models: Implementing AI-driven models to evaluate and mitigate potential risks.
The implementation process involved several key steps:
Data Integration: Aggregating historical and real-time financial data from various sources.
Model Training: Developing and training machine learning models, including DRL agents, to understand and predict market behaviors.
Strategy Development: Designing trading strategies that align with investment objectives and risk tolerance.
System Deployment: Integrating the AI models into the trading infrastructure for real-time execution.
Continuous Monitoring and Optimization: Regularly updating models and strategies to adapt to changing market conditions.
